                    From MattyCollector: Catra's Wrath's latest responses in regards to this issue:

                    * "There is nothing to announce for Snake Mountain at this time. As announced at the time of reveal, Snake Mountain (much like Castle Grayskull before it) would not go into production until a pre-sale period had been completed and a minimum order target requirement met."

                    * "
                    There are many rumours floating around at the moment, but they are rumours and assumption. Until you hear an official statement from Mattel on any product - take things with a pinch of salt."
